'66 122s B18D consistently runs with temp gauge above mid range, right on 3/4 (3rd white square / between M and P in word TEMP). Warms up fine at idle in 4-5 minutes. Drives nice and smooth. Fun.
Richened carbs half turn each. Cleaned K&N air filters. Had radiator tanked/cleaned. Replaced hoses. New coolant. Routed around heater core (was leaking on floor). Cleaned and reinstalled thermostat (new one on order). Gauge and sending unit untouched. Runs without losing coolant (no coolant overflow tank). Still runs dead on 3/4.
If I didn't see that gauge sitting past mid range(never goes to hot), I wouldn't know there was an issue.
When going down 5% grade hill it cools to mid range, then after bottom goes back up and stays right on 3/4.
Any ideas? My other 122 and my 240 run dead on mid gauge.
How do you cool off a stock 66 122? How to calibrate gauge?
